I am a Apple fan, but wanted to venture out and learn about android. I sold off my iPad, and tried several android tablets (Acer A100, Asus Transformer). I settled not he Samsung 10.1 as I liked the design style.
I had it for the past 5 days and today I was at Best Buy and traded it in for a 8.9 model.
So far I feel the 8.9 is an ideal size for what i want. I have a nook which I can now sale as I feel the 8.9 is a good reading size. Also the 8.9 seems to be more portable.
So far as a new used to the droid universe, I feel it is more capable than the apple system and I really enjoy going to webpages which actually work. I could all the apps I used on my iPad in the droid so the fact the number of apps is greater not he iPad side is mute to me. (how many fart noise makers do you need).
The only thing I find as s design flaw of the 10.1 and the 8.9 is the placement of the charging port and headphone jacket. They placed them on direct opposite sides. It seems if I wanted to watch sling box in bed I have to choose between listening through the speakers and charging, or using headphones and not charging.
Also I noticed some apps do not rotate which is ok except when it the case in a inclined position, I must change to position of the 10.1 in the case. I thin this was on my sling box app.
But overall love the droid universe and looking to getting a Galaxy S2 and ditch the iphone4
